Re:Kill Switch
I just put on an awesome Dodge Diesel Immobilizer switch. Even if you have the key it will not start. It cuts out the fuel pumps along with the power to the key at the same time. It puts a LED in the overhead display to see it is on. The on switch uses the door lock/push switch in the cab your choice. The off switch is very unique. The best part of the whole thing.
